2.11 Stances
Changing stance is a big part of gameplay. The essential concept to master is using the correct combat position for each situation.
Generally speaking, as you go down the list accuracy will increase and movement is quieter. On the other hand, as you go up the chain of stance movement is quicker and aiming time can be reduced. This is an obvious trade off system that gives you a lot of options on the battlefield.
Ready
Mercs can move quickly but maintain a higher degree of accuracy than running. It is not as quiet as crouching or going prone but it does hamper noise a little. It is the highest active stance that can allow your squad to aim over objects. Unless you need to cover a lot of ground, this should be the default stance to keep your mercs ready to respond...
